Vagabond Living
The winds of time whisper but one tune and it enthuses- The gloomy senses of a dreamy person with a shining mind. Says to him; your life resides in travelling the world, dear son: The waves call you unto them, with sun o'erhead and deep within. In silent dreams cruises the aspiration of an enigmatic soul- On the calm waves of youth, driven by a carefree fuel. For the ocean is vast and glorious; and there are numerous isles On which hopes could be docked and a life could be harboured. Every person desires at least once, to live like a vagabond- To move about places relentlessly and to flow like the wind. Bearing the scent of people and the sound of life they go, From place to place, revering everything from a corner of their souls. -The Silent Poet
